There is a set of N.O. contacts on Pins 5 and 8 of the Jones connector 
that close on transmit that can be used to ground the relay in the 
Ameritron. They are rated at 2 A at 250 VAC so no problem handling the 
relay current. If you're using an AC-4 power supply, these contacts are 
wired to the two-pin connector on the side of the AC-4 marked VOX.

The TR-4C expects a negative ALC voltage from the linear. If the 
Ameritron provides this, it will work, but may require some sort of 
level adjustment. The TR-4C has MUCH too much power output to drive a 1 
kW linear. Aside from the fact that the amp is less than one-half 
S-Unit increase in signal strength over the TR-4C, you will need some 
sort of resistive pad between the two to keep from overdriving the 
amp. The TR-4C will put out 200+ watts and the AMP will probably put 
out 500.
